Unless something big changed since I last actively played and just came back few weeks ago, couldn't you just transfer stored modules?

Station A is locked down or quarantined, goto any Station X and pay to ship/transfer your module and equip it there once arrived. This change?
 
For convenience, store all your modules on the nearest detention centre - you can only get stored modules there, but it can't be put into Lockdown.

Is there a way to get the station out of Lockdown? Or you just gotta wait it out?
In 3.2, the quickest way is to push the station's controlling faction into Retreat in another system, though War, Expansion, Civil War or Election may sometimes be easier to set up. You can in theory bounty hunt your way out of them, but in most cases this takes a lot longer.
(On the other hand, Lockdowns create Threat 5-7 pirate signal sources, which are great for high-end combat and materials, so it's not all bad)

In 3.3 that won't work and bounty hunting is likely to be the best way out - but, you're likely to get more warning since it will probably have to go through Civil Unrest first. Regular bounty hunting may make Lockdowns far less likely.
